How to Clean a Meerschaum Pipe Without Damaging It?

Cleaning a meerschaum pipe is not just about keeping it looking good. It directly affects how the pipe performs, how it ages, and how long it lasts.

But unlike other materials, meerschaum requires a different approach. What works for briar or other pipes can damage meerschaum permanently.

This is where many mistakes happen.

If cleaned incorrectly, a meerschaum pipe can lose its structure, develop uneven coloring, or even crack. If cleaned properly, it can last for years while developing its natural character.

Why Meerschaum Requires Special Care

Meerschaum is a porous and delicate mineral. This means it interacts with moisture, heat, and oils differently than other materials.

Because of this structure:

  • It absorbs substances over time

  • It is more sensitive to liquid exposure

  • It can be damaged by aggressive cleaning methods

Cleaning is not about force. It is about control and consistency.

What You Should Never Do When Cleaning Meerschaum

Before explaining how to clean it, it is more important to understand what should be avoided.

Never wash a meerschaum pipe with water. Even small amounts can affect the structure of the material.

Avoid using alcohol directly on the exterior. This can damage the surface and interfere with natural aging.

Do not scrub aggressively. Meerschaum is not a hard wood. Pressure can cause micro-damage.

Do not try to speed up cleaning with heat or chemicals. This often leads to irreversible damage.

Most problems happen not because of neglect, but because of over-cleaning.

How to Clean a Meerschaum Pipe Step by Step

Cleaning should be done regularly but gently. The process is simple when done correctly.

Start by letting the pipe cool completely. Cleaning a warm pipe can cause stress on the material.

Remove the stem carefully. Do not twist aggressively. If it feels tight, wait before forcing it.

Use a pipe cleaner to clean the airway. This removes residue without applying pressure.

For the bowl, gently tap out loose ash. Avoid scraping too hard. A thin carbon layer is normal and should not be completely removed.

If needed, use a dry, soft cloth to wipe the exterior. This helps remove surface oils without affecting the material.

The key is consistency, not intensity.

How Often Should You Clean a Meerschaum Pipe?

Light cleaning should be done after each use. This includes removing ash and running a pipe cleaner through the stem.

A more thorough cleaning can be done periodically, depending on usage.

However, frequent deep cleaning is not necessary. Over-cleaning can be just as harmful as not cleaning at all.

Can You Use Alcohol to Clean Meerschaum?

Alcohol can be used in very limited cases, but only with caution.

It should never be applied directly to the exterior surface.

If used at all, it should be applied lightly to the airway using a pipe cleaner, not poured or soaked.

Even then, this should not be done frequently.

In most cases, dry cleaning methods are sufficient.

What About Waxing and Polishing?

Some meerschaum pipes are treated with wax to enhance their appearance and aging process.

If waxing is needed, it should be done carefully and infrequently.

Using the wrong type of wax or applying too much can block the natural properties of the material.

Polishing should always be gentle and done with a soft cloth.

Common Mistakes That Damage Meerschaum Pipes

Many users damage their pipes without realizing it.

Using water is one of the most common mistakes.

Over-scraping the bowl is another. Trying to remove every trace of residue can do more harm than good.

Applying chemicals or cleaning solutions designed for other materials is also risky.

And perhaps the most common mistake is treating meerschaum like a standard pipe material.

It is not.
